Lets compare vitamin content per 1 pound of Sunflower Seeds vs Canned Red Kidney Beans:
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els have 22.1 times more Vitamin B1, 22.2 times more Vitamin B2, 18.1 times more Vitamin B3, 8.1 times more Vitamin B9 and 7 times more Vitamin C than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ids.
Both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els as well as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 1 lb.
Comparing minerals per 1 pound for Sunflower Seeds vs Canned Red Kidney Beans:
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els have 1.4 times more Calcium, 6.6 times more Copper, 3.5 times more Iron, 10.8 times more Magnesium, 5.1 times more Manganese, 5.5 times more Phosphorus, 2.3 times more Potassium, 33.1 times more Selenium and 6.7 times more Zinc than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ids.
While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ids contain 25.7 times more Sodium and 14.4 times more Water than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 1 pound:
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els have 4.7 times more Energy, 49 times more Fat, 24.6 times more Saturated Fat, 192.1 times more Omega 6, 1.6 times more Fiber and 2.6 times more Protein than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ids.
While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ids contain 1.5 times more Sugars than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els.
Both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els and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ids have similar amounts of Omega 3 and Carbohydrate per 1 lb.
Both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els as well as Canned Red Kidney Beans, Solids have insufficient amounts of Cholesterol, Glucose and Sucrose in 1 lb.
